This thread got me thinking, and sure enough, between all the switching between my Suburban and Stepside, I had the TBI water pump and no bypass hole in the heads. I nabbed a water pump at Pull-A-Part and switched it out this weekend. Here are some pics of the differences.
The water pump on the left is the older-style internal bypass water pump. On the right is the Vortec non-bypass water pump.
View media item 32317Note the two tubes at the top. The one on the left goes to your heater core. The one on the right goes to the heater hose outlet on your intake manifold.
There's also some discussion about Vortec water pumps on TBI blocks, and this pic shows why. The old style pump on the left has a coolant port under the bolt hole on the passenger side, while the Vortec on the right does not. The port in the block is between sizes for a standard bolt thread, so I tapped mine metric and found a bolt that would thread in it. I cut the head off the bolt, put a slot in it for a flathead screwdriver, put some RTV on it, and threaded it in until it was flush.
